ABSTRACT

A method is described for the assessment of renal calculi by means of a computerized IR spectrometer. A preliminary reference library of IR spectra of 34 different renal calculi of known composition has been created. The reference library used in the operation of a computerized search program indicates the closest matches in the reference library data with the IR spectrum of an unknown sample. The computerized method of characterizing renal calculi has the advantage that it greatly reduces the likelihood of introducing errors because of operator bias in the subjective interpretation of spectral data.

ABSTRACT

A clinical evaluation of a quantitative infrared method for lecithin and sphingomyelin is described. The method incorporates techniques of computer-assisted infrared spectroscopy for both control of the microprocessor-based infrared spectrophotometer and for evaluation of the data. An advanced software package for quantitative infrared analysis, which can operate on a microcomputer, provides the possibility of complete automation of the analysis. Results of the analyses of amniotic fluids from 20 patients are presented. In general, the results of the analysis of the lecithin/sphingomyelin ratio by the infrared method correspond closely to those obtained by two-dimensional thin-layer chromatography on the same respective samples.
